Oracle 深入浅出-初级篇.ppt的讲解涵盖了Oracle数据库的基础知识和入门要点,由主讲人邹振兴引导。Oracle数据库是目前最强大的、速度最快的主流数据库之一,广泛应用于各类业务场景,因此掌握Oracle技能对IT从业者极具价值。
学习Oracle的原因在于其在就业市场上的高需求,熟悉Oracle数据库或SQL语言可以显著提升软件开发人员的竞争力。Oracle公司,作为一家上市公司,是数据库软件领域的领军者,始于1977年,由劳伦斯·埃里森创立,其关系数据库是首个支持SQL语言的产品。Oracle公司历经多次重大收购,如Primavera和Sun Microsystems,进一步扩展了其在项目管理和硬件领域的影响力。
在Oracle的基本应用部分,初学者会接触到如何安装Oracle,这通常包括在Windows环境下安装Oracle 10g的步骤,以及安装过程中创建的默认用户,如拥有最高权限的sys用户、操作员级别的system用户,以及用于演示的scott用户。安装完成后,还需要启动Oracle的两个关键服务:OracleOraDb10g_home1TNSListener(数据库监听器)和OracleServiceORCL(数据库服务),以确保数据库系统正常运行。
Sqlplus是Oracle提供的一种命令行工具,用于执行SQL查询、DML操作和数据库管理任务。理解如何使用Sqlplus是Oracle初级学习的重要环节,它允许用户直接与数据库交互,执行增、删、查、改等基本操作,以及管理权限和对象。
此外,课程还将深入到Oracle的高级应用,如事务管理,事务是数据库操作的基本单元,保证数据的一致性和完整性;索引,用于加速查询速度,提高数据检索效率;视图,提供数据的虚拟表,简化复杂的查询和数据访问;触发器,自动响应特定的数据库事件,实现数据的自动处理;过程,存储的PL/SQL代码块,可重复执行,增强数据库的业务逻辑处理能力。
Oracle数据库的学习是一个循序渐进的过程,从基础的权限管理、表结构创建,到复杂的查询优化和程序设计,每一个环节都对理解和掌握Oracle数据库至关重要。通过这个初级篇的教程,学习者将能够建立起对Oracle数据库系统的全面认识,并为进一步深入学习打下坚实基础。